Cut Copper is a block in Minecraft 1.21.4 that requires Stone Pickaxe or better to mine, dropping Cut Copper.

What is Cut Copper?

Cut Copper is a Minecraft block classified under the Requires better than wooden tool material group. It has a hardness of 3 and a blast resistance of 6. It stacks up to 64 per inventory slot. It is a solid, opaque block. Cut Copper does not emit light. Cut Copper filters 15 levels of light passing through it, which is why it blocks skylight below it.

Namespaced identifier: minecraft:cut_copper. Command: /give @p minecraft:cut_copper 1.

How to mine Cut Copper

Cut Copper requires one of the following tools to drop its item — mining with a lower tier or by hand destroys it:

Break times (unenchanted, no Haste or Mining Fatigue):

  • With the correct tool: approximately 4.5 seconds
  • By hand (no tool): approximately 15 seconds

Using an Efficiency-enchanted tool, Haste beacons, or a Diamond/Netherite tier drastically reduces these times. Water and being airborne slow mining by 5×.

Frequently Asked Questions

What tool do I need to mine Cut Copper?

You need one of: Stone Pickaxe, Iron Pickaxe, Diamond Pickaxe, Netherite Pickaxe. Mining with a lower tier tool (or by hand) will break the block without dropping its item.
